DEV Community

Cover image for Agile Software Development: Custom Solutions & AI Innovation
Andrew Wade
Andrew Wade

Posted on • Edited on

Agile Software Development: Custom Solutions & AI Innovation

Welcome to our blog on Agile Software Development. In this post, we share expert ideas about custom software development. We also talk about AI and its impact on technology. We start with a compelling look at Agile Software Development and its growing role. Our software development agency uses agile methods every day. This post explains why agile methods are the best for custom software development. We discuss the role of Transformer Model Development Services. We show how a software development firm or company can benefit from these methods. Our discussion helps you understand agile and its impact on the tech world.

Agile Software Development is a smart way to build custom software. It uses flexible and fast methods that work well. We see the value in these methods every day. This blog gives a simple view of how agile and AI work together. It also explains the benefits for businesses that need custom software. You will learn the main ideas and trends. Let us dive into the world of agile methods and AI.

Understanding Agile Software Development

Agile Software Development is a way to create software quickly. It uses short work cycles called sprints, each with a clear goal. The team meets often to check on progress. Agile methods make it easy to change direction if necessary and help teams work better together.

Core Principles of Agile Methodology

Agile methods focus on people and small, working pieces of software. They stress teamwork and clear goals. Teams plan in short bursts and adjust quickly. This method helps teams learn from mistakes and fix them quickly. Every team member feels valued. They share ideas and work as one.

Agile Software Development builds on:

  • A focus on people over strict processes.
  • Continuous improvement through feedback.

Benefits of Agile in Software Development

Agile Software Development offers many benefits. It makes it easy to change plans if needed, and teams can fix problems quickly. They deliver parts of the software in short cycles. This method helps teams use time effectively. Clients see results much faster. It also builds trust because progress is shared often.

Agile methods help in many ways:

  • They reduce waste and improve efficiency.
  • They boost morale by keeping everyone involved.

Agile vs. Traditional Software Development Approaches

Agile methods differ from old ways of making software. Traditional methods use long plans and fixed steps. Agile is flexible and can change as needed. Agile teams meet often and adjust quickly. Traditional teams can be slow to fix mistakes. Agile Software Development saves time and energy. It meets client needs with speed and care.

The Power of Custom Software Solutions

Custom software development gives a special touch to each project. Many businesses need software that fits them perfectly. They cannot use one-size-fits-all tools. A software development agency helps create the right software. Custom software is built to solve a unique problem. It makes work easier and saves time.

Why Businesses Need Custom Software Solutions

Many companies need solutions that work just for them. They want a design that fits their work style. A custom solution makes work faster and more fun. It also makes the company stand out. In a busy market, custom tools help businesses win.

Also read: How 5G is Transforming Electronic Clinical Trial Management

The reasons are simple:

  • It fits the business's specific needs.
  • It grows as the business grows.

Key Industries Benefiting from Custom Development

Many industries use custom software. Retail companies use it to track sales. Healthcare providers use it for patient records. Finance firms use it for secure transactions. Each of these fields needs special tools. A software development firm can create these tools with agile methods. Custom software meets the unique needs of each industry. It helps companies work better and faster.

How Agile Methodology Enhances Custom Software Development

Agile Software Development brings speed to custom software projects. It makes sure each part of the software works well. Agile teams work in short sprints and learn quickly. They meet often to check work. This method helps fix errors fast. Clients see progress and give feedback. This teamwork improves the final product. The process makes sure that the custom solution is built right.

AI’s Role in Modern Software Development

Artificial Intelligence changes how we build software. AI tools help developers work fast. They test code, find bugs, and suggest fixes. This speeds up the project. AI makes work smoother and more accurate. Many software development companies use AI every day. The use of Transformer Model Development Services shows how AI leads innovation.

Overview of AI in Software Development

AI helps teams in many ways. It can write simple code and test software. It saves time and reduces human error. This technology works with agile methods. Agile Software Development and AI are a strong mix. Together, they help teams work smart. AI takes over simple tasks so humans can focus on design.

Transformer Models and Their Impact on Software Innovation

Transformer models are a type of AI that change how we see data. They are used in many smart apps. A software development company can use these models to predict needs. They also improve custom software development. This technology helps with language tasks and data analysis. Agile teams use these tools to work better. It is a new wave of software agile methods that boost efficiency.

Also read: Will AI Replace Web Developers? The Future of AI in Web Development

AI-Driven Automation in Agile Workflows

AI-driven automation makes agile teams even more agile. It helps in testing and debugging code. AI finds mistakes faster than human eyes. This means teams fix issues sooner. AI also takes on repetitive tasks. With this help, teams can work on creative solutions. Automation makes the whole process faster and more fun.

Integrating AI with Agile Development

Agile Software Development and AI work well together. They improve how projects are managed. AI helps teams plan and check their work. It also makes testing smooth and quick. When agile and AI join, the project runs better.

How AI Enhances Agile Project Management

AI tools support project management in agile teams. They keep track of work and suggest improvements. This makes meetings more effective. Agile Software Development moves forward faster with AI. Teams can see trends and adjust quickly. AI makes planning easier and clearer.

AI-Driven Testing, Debugging, and Automation

In an agile project, testing is vital. AI helps by automating many tests. It finds errors before they grow. Agile teams fix these errors with ease. Debugging becomes a simple task. AI-driven automation speeds up the work. This mix of AI and agile saves time and boosts quality.

Case Studies: AI-Powered Agile Development Success Stories

Several companies share success with agile and AI. One software development agency used agile methods with AI. They cut development time by nearly half. Another software development firm used Transformer Model Development Services. They created software that adapts to customer needs quickly. These examples show the power of combining agile methods with AI. Success comes from a smart mix of technology and teamwork.

Future of Agile and AI in Software Development

The future looks bright for agile methods and AI. Agile Software Development is set to grow even more. AI will drive smarter and faster work. New trends are on the horizon. Companies will use more custom software development to meet specific needs.

Emerging Trends in AI-Powered Software Development

New ideas are emerging every day. AI tools will get smarter. They will predict what teams need before the need arises. Agile teams will use these tools to get ahead. This trend shows great promise for a bright future.

The Role of AI in Improving Agile Methodologies

AI will help agile methods become even better. It will suggest ways to improve workflow. It can also highlight potential issues early. Agile teams will rely on AI to stay flexible. This support will lead to faster and more accurate work. Agile Software Development will continue to lead in this field.

Predictions for the Future of Agile, Custom Software, and AI

Experts predict that agile methods will grow in popularity. More businesses will choose custom software development. AI will become a key part of every project. Agile Software Development will continue to thrive as a smart way to build software. These predictions show a future full of innovation. Companies that adapt will lead the market.

Also read: Why Backlinks Are Crucial for SEO Success?

Conclusion

This blog explored Agile Software Development and its benefits for custom solutions and AI innovation. We learned how agile methods, custom software, and AI work together. We saw that agile is better than traditional methods. We also examined how Transformer Model Development Services help drive progress. Agile and AI make software development faster, smarter, and more adaptable.

AWS Security LIVE!

Join us for AWS Security LIVE!

Discover the future of cloud security. Tune in live for trends, tips, and solutions from AWS and AWS Partners.

Learn More

Top comments (0)

👋 Kindness is contagious

If you found this post helpful, please leave a ❤️ or a friendly comment below!

Okay